American Conifer Society Records
The American Conifer Society Records include correspondence, ACS Bulletin materials, Board of Directors' meeting minutes, audiotapes of Board of Directors' meetings, financial records, incorporation documents, by-laws and policies, contracts, ACS national meetings materials, members' plant inventories, materials related to the slide program "A Brief Look at Garden Conifers," ACS Central Region meeting files, locations of ACS national meetings (1983-2001), and membership directories.

Gene Eisenbeiss Papers
The Gene Eisenbeiss Papers include administrative files, such as correspondence regarding registration of cultivar names, location of cultivars for purchase, and information requested about the Ilex genus (holly and its relatives). There are also miscellaneous publications and literature on plants, as well as engraving blocks of holly illustrations used for publications and given to Eisenbeiss by Harry William Dengler of the Extension Service, USDA, at the University of Maryland.

Prince Family Papers
The Prince Family Papers contain correspondence, account books, notebooks, and journals that provide an insight into the difficulties of maintaining a large nursery in the early years of the United States. Much of the material concerns business dealings between members of the Prince family and those transacting business with them. The remaining portion of the material deals with observations on and experiments with plants.
Society of American Florists Records and Book Collection
The Society of American Florists Records and Book Collection consists of both organizational records and bound volumes. The Society of American Florists (SAF) Records cover the period from 1894 to 1993, and contain proceedings, meeting minutes, correspondence, memoranda, publications, photographs, and scrapbooks. The SAF Book Collection consists of over 200 volumes, including monographs and bound serials from 1793 to 1990.
